Interesting. Are you using an intuos or a cintiq?

For me, so far:
productivity issues

  • Fill colors jumping all over the place (only on the cintiq screen, not always repeatable, horrifically annoying),
  • randomly duplicating elements instead of moving them on drag,
  • various tools not responding to being selected.
  • No trace function?

annoying to me (although possible that I am not using various tools correctly)

  • I finally found where I could turn on the pressure sensitivity. Variable width brushes should have this on by default. A wacom/touch options menu in the prefs would be grand.
  • Full screen mode hides the file menu bar. Stop that.
  • Joining strokes requires using “actions” that are (to me, right now) not at all intuitive.
  • If I drag a bezier curve node all the way back into the anchor point, I can’t then grab the anchor point and move it… i just end up grabbing the curve node again. Gotta click off, then back, or convert node type.
  • Holding spacebar during another operation (like dragging an element) does not switch to pan. You must end the operation, then pan.
  • Auto zoom-in (there has got to be a way to turn this off, but I haven’t looked hard enough I guess)
  • No offset functions (the dev team has been “working on it” for well over a year)
  • Pixel Persona: raster effects for screen or print. Breaks vectors: no go for vector computer control of cutting hardware like my plotter, or the glowforge.
  • The forum has a search function delay. If I get zero results, don’t punish me by making wait to ask it in another way. Not enough other sources of info online yet. (that will change over time, and there is always the book, but I’m not gonna buy it just for the free ten-day trial)

Things I like:
great object-to-object distance guides and rulers. (can’t find how to turn them back on, but when they were there they were great)
Different snapping modes.
Great selection of pre-made, adjustable shape tools.
Layers are malleable in interesting ways. haven’t gotten far enough in to really know, but I certainly appreciate the “create layer from group” function.
Eyedropper tool works to grab color from bitmap photo asset. (that is awesome)
Save history with document.

One feature that is missing from Affinity and AI (and maybe inkscape, i dunno), but which has existed in Flexi for years: Throw Shadows.

that’s all for now.
